  2. Pickup coil resistance • Disconnect the A.C. magneto coupler from the wire harness. • Connect the multimeter(Ω × 100) to the pickup coil terminal. Tester (+) lead Green/White terminal ① Tester (–) lead Blue/White terminal ② • Check the pickup coil for the specified resistance. Pickup coil resistance 459 ~ 561 Ω at 20 °C (68 °F) (White/Red – White/Green)

  8. I would look for a short to ground. Also, check coil and pick-up. I know u replaced trigger, check it anyway! Primary coil resistance 0.18 ~ 0.28 Ω at 20 °C (68 °F) • Connect the multimeter(Ω × 1k) to the ignition coil. Tester (+) lead Orange lead terminal Tester (–) lead Spark plug lead • Check that the secondary coil has the specified resistance. Secondary coil resistance 6.32 ~ 9.48 kΩ at 20 °C (68 °F)

The camshaft sensor should be located near stator. Look at the service manual, it can be called several names, trigger coil, pulsar, etc. You must test and eliminate each component separately before buying new parts. You will need a service manual and multimeter for testing. Most of the time, the problem will be small, generally a short on the ground side of the circuit due to corrosion or loose wire. The problem will require resistance, voltage drop, and continuity testing. You must be methodical and pay strict attention to detail

  15. Would need more information as to the make or model. A coil usually has a positive and negative and the wiring goes to a CDI, ECM or some other form of igniter. The pick up coil, pulsar, trigger coil (or whatever you choose to call it) is often located at the stator and is activated by a reluctor on the flywheel or near the crankshaft depending on the type of equipment. Sounds like you have a short based on the information provided. You will require a wiring diagram and a multimeter to troubleshoot the various components and circuits.
